Ms Noelle O'Connell:

Thank you, Chairman. Ms Coady, Ms Gayson and Ms Lambe referred to improvements that could be made in the history and CSPE courses. The fact that it is no longer compulsory to study history for the junior certificate is an issue that is of some concern to me in this regard in a personal capacity. At primary level, European Movement Ireland runs a Blue Star programme, of which the Chairman and committee have been very supportive.
